The Meaning Behind Ivette: A Bow and Arrow of Nature
Let's start with what makes Ivette so special. The name traces back to the French 'Yvette,' which itself comes from 'Yves,' stemming from the Old French 'Ivo,' meaning 'yew.' Now, what’s fascinating is that the yew tree isn’t just any tree; it’s a symbol of endurance and resilience. Historically, yew wood was prized for making longbows — hence the connection to archery. So, Ivette carries the meaning 'yew; archer,' blending natural beauty with a warrior’s precision.

Fun Facts and Trivia
Did you know the yew tree, linked to Ivette’s meaning, is one of Europe’s longest-living trees? It’s often planted in churchyards, symbolizing eternal life. Also, yew wood’s role in crafting longbows makes Ivette a name subtly connected to medieval legends and the art of archery.

Nicknames and Variations: Personalizing Ivette
From Ivy and Ettie to Vivi and Vette, Ivette offers plenty of sweet nicknames. Variations like Yvette or Iveta give you options to suit different tastes, whether you prefer classic or modern vibes.
